What Is Enterprise Data Management?

To understand its impact, we first need to define what it actually means.

Enterprise data management is the process of collecting, organizing, storing, and maintaining data across an entire organization. It ensures that data is accurate, consistent, and easily accessible when needed.

Key Components

Data Integration

Combining data from different sources into a single system so teams can access it easily.

Data Quality Management

Ensuring that data is accurate, complete, and up to date.

Data Governance

Setting rules and policies for how data is used and managed.

Data Security

Protecting sensitive information from unauthorized access or breaches.

Breaking Down Data Silos

One of the biggest challenges organizations face is data silos. These occur when different departments store data separately, making it difficult to share information.

The Problem with Silos

When data is isolated, teams cannot see the full picture. This leads to miscommunication and poor decisions.

Unified Data Systems

Enterprise data management eliminates silos by integrating data across departments. Everyone works with the same information, improving collaboration and decision-making.
